Trade schools often have a variety of social groups and clubs that students can join. These groups can be a great way to meet new people and make friends. Some of the most popular social groups and clubs at trade schools include:
Groups | Activities |
---|---|
Sports clubs | Basketball, volleyball, football, etc. |
Student government | Participate in school governance, organize events |
Honor societies | Recognize academic achievements |
Vocational clubs | Focus on specific trade areas, like welding or carpentry |
When choosing a social group or club to join, it’s important to consider your interests and goals. If you’re looking to meet people who share your passion for a particular trade, then joining a vocational club would be a good option. If you’re more interested in getting involved in school activities, then student government might be a better fit. No matter what your interests are, there’s sure to be a social group or club at your trade school that’s right for you.
In addition to providing opportunities to meet new people, social groups and clubs can also help you develop your leadership skills, teamwork abilities, and communication skills. These are all valuable skills that can help you succeed in your career. So if you’re looking for a way to make new friends and learn new skills, joining a social group or club at your trade school is a great option.

Develop Your Communication Skills
Mastering communication is pivotal in finding a girlfriend. Effective communication builds rapport, facilitates connection, and fosters understanding. Here’s how to enhance your communication abilities:
- Be an Active Listener: Pay undivided attention when others speak, demonstrate that you’re engaged by nodding, and ask clarifying questions to show comprehension.
- Speak Clearly and Confidently: Project your voice with clarity, articulate your thoughts precisely, and maintain eye contact to convey confidence and interest.
- Be a Respectful Conversationalist: Listen to others’ opinions without interrupting, avoid dominating the conversation, and use respectful language regardless of differing perspectives.
- Use Nonverbal Cues: Body language speaks volumes. Maintain open posture, make appropriate eye contact, and use gestures to enhance your verbal communication.
- Be Empathetic: Understand and relate to others’ feelings. Try to see situations from their perspective and respond with compassion and understanding.
- Develop a Sense of Humor: Sharing laughter is a powerful bonding experience. Use humor appropriately to lighten the mood and create a relaxed atmosphere.
- Practice Regularly: Improve your communication skills through daily conversations, participating in group discussions, or joining a Toastmasters club to hone your public speaking abilities.
Effective communication is a crucial aspect of building and maintaining relationships. By developing your communication skills, you’ll increase your chances of finding a girlfriend and fostering a lasting connection.
